Victron SmartSolar MPPT 250/100-MC4 VE.Can Bluetooth Solar Charge Controller

High-Performance MPPT Solar Charge Controller for 12V, 24V, and 48V Systems

The Victron SmartSolar MPPT 100A charge controller brings advanced Maximum Power Point Tracking (MPPT) technology to your off-grid, mobile, or backup power system. Designed to extract the maximum possible energy from your solar array, this controller uses ultra-fast MPPT tracking to adapt to changing light conditions—delivering up to 30% more energy than traditional PWM controllers and up to 10% more than slower MPPT units, especially under cloudy or partially shaded skies.

With a peak conversion efficiency of 99% and full rated output up to 40°C, this controller operates without a cooling fan, ensuring silent, reliable performance. The built-in Bluetooth Smart interface allows wireless setup, monitoring, and firmware updates via the free VictronConnect app, while the VE.Can port enables wired integration with GX devices and parallel synchronisation of multiple controllers for larger systems.

Ultra-Fast MPPT and Advanced Shading Response

In real-world conditions, clouds and partial shading can cause conventional MPPT controllers to lock onto a local power peak, missing the true maximum power point. The Victron SmartSolar algorithm continuously scans the full power-voltage curve to lock onto the optimal MPP, maximising energy harvest even when shadows fall across part of your array. This is especially valuable for installations on vehicles, boats, or rooftops where shading is unavoidable.

Flexible Charging for Any Battery Chemistry

The controller supports 12V, 24V, and 48V battery banks with automatic voltage detection, and includes eight pre-programmed charge algorithms for lead-acid, AGM, gel, and lithium batteries. A fully user-definable charge profile is also available, giving you complete control over absorption, float, and equalisation voltages. Temperature compensation is built in, and optional external voltage and temperature sensing via a Smart Battery Sense or BMV-712 Smart Battery Monitor ensures precise charging even when the controller is mounted away from the battery.

Robust Protection and Reliable Operation

Engineered for demanding environments, the SmartSolar MPPT includes comprehensive electronic protection: PV reverse polarity, PV short circuit, over-temperature, and PV reverse current protection. The electronics are rated IP43, while the connection area is IP22, making it suitable for indoor, unconditioned spaces. With an operating range of -30°C to +60°C and an altitude rating of up to 5000 m, this controller is built to perform in Australia’s harshest climates.

Seamless System Integration

The SmartSolar MPPT is designed to work as part of a complete Victron energy system. Connect it to a Color Control GX or other GX device via VE.Can for centralised monitoring and control, or use Bluetooth to synchronise up to 10 controllers in parallel. For larger arrays, VE.Can allows up to 25 units to operate in synchronised parallel mode, sharing charge current evenly across multiple controllers.

The programmable relay can be configured to trigger on low battery voltage, high temperature, or other events, while the remote on/off input allows a BMS or other external device to disable charging when needed. With 46 days of historical data storage, you can review solar yield, battery voltage, and charge trends directly in the VictronConnect app.

Built for Australian Conditions

From the tropical north to the arid interior, Australian solar installations face extreme heat, dust, and humidity. The SmartSolar MPPT’s convection-cooled design eliminates fan failures, while the fully potted electronics resist moisture and corrosion. The controller derates power gracefully above 40°C, protecting itself and your batteries without sudden shutdowns.

Installation is straightforward with MC4 PV connectors for quick, weatherproof solar array connections and 35 mm² (AWG2) battery terminals that accept heavy-gauge cable for minimal voltage drop. The compact footprint (246 × 295 × 103 mm) and 4.5 kg weight make it easy to mount in tight spaces such as vehicle compartments or electrical cabinets.

Specifications

SmartSolar Charge Controller with VE.Can interface 250/100 (MC4)
Battery voltage 12 / 24 / 48 V Auto Select (36 V: manual)
Rated charge current 100 A
Nominal PV power, 12 V 1a,b) 1450 W
Nominal PV power, 24 V 1a,b) 2900 W
Nominal PV power, 36 V 1a,b) 4350 W
Nominal PV power, 48 V 1a,b) 5800 W
Max. PV short circuit current 2) 70 A (max 30 A per MC4 connector)
Maximum PV open circuit voltage 250 V absolute maximum (coldest conditions) 245 V start-up and operating maximum
Maximum efficiency 99 %
Self-consumption Less than 35 mA @ 12 V / 20 mA @ 48 V
Charge voltage ‘absorption’ Default setting: 14.4 / 28.8 / 43.2 / 57.6 V (adjustable with: rotary switch, display, VE.Direct or Bluetooth)
Charge voltage ‘float’ Default setting: 13.8 / 27.6 / 41.4 / 55.2 V (adjustable: rotary switch, display, VE.Direct or Bluetooth)
Charge voltage ‘equalisation’ Default setting: 16.2 / 32.4 / 48.6 / 64.8 V (adjustable)
Charge algorithm Multi-stage adaptive (eight pre-programmed algorithms) or user-defined algorithm
Temperature compensation -16 mV / -32 mV / -64 mV / °C
Protection PV reverse polarity / Output short circuit / Over temperature
Operating temperature -30 to +60 °C (full rated output up to 40 °C)
Humidity 95 %, non-condensing
Maximum altitude 5000 m (full rated output up to 2000 m)
Environmental condition Indoor, unconditioned
Pollution degree PD3
Data communication VE.Can, VE.Direct and Bluetooth
Remote on/off Yes (2-pole connector)
Programmable relay DPST AC rating: 240 VAC / 4 A DC rating: 4 A up to 35 VDC, 1 A up to 60 VDC
Parallel operation Yes, parallel synchronised operation with VE.Can (max. 25 units) or Bluetooth (max. 10 units)
Colour Blue (RAL 5012)
PV terminals 3) Two pairs of MC4 connectors
Battery terminals 35 mm² / AWG2
Protection category IP43 (electronic components), IP22 (connection area)
Weight 4.5 kg
Dimensions (h × w × d) 246 × 295 × 103 mm
Safety EN/IEC 62109-1, UL 1741, CSA C22.2
Data stored Battery voltage, current and temperature, as well as load output current, PV voltage and PV current
Number of days trends data is stored 46
